Real Madrid president Florentino Perez plans to be busy in the January market.
Trailing Barcelona by five points in the LaLiga race and battling for form in the Champions League, Perez recognises his squad needs to be freshened up.
Don Balon says intermediaries have been dispatched across Europe to start testing the ground about bringing in their top transfer targets over the New Year.
The summer market is the focus, however buying in January has not been ruled out.
David De Gea (Manchester United), Kepa (Athletic Bilbao), Harry Kane (Tottenham), Icardi (Inter Milan) ... all are on the list.
But in addition, another surprise may come. Players like Eden Hazard (Chelsea), Antoine Griezmann (Atletico Madrid) and Paulo Dybala (Juventus) are also on the agenda.
A Galactico, or two, is now the transfer focus for Perez.
